Why Businesses Are Embedding Chatbots in Applications
Traditional chatbots typically lived on websites or messaging platforms. While they handled customer queries, they rarely connected deeply with business systems.
Modern AI chatbots are different. When embedded directly inside applications, they can access workflows, perform actions, and retrieve business data instantly. This creates a much more powerful user experience.
For example, inside a CRM application, a chatbot can:
- Retrieve customer history
- Update contact information
- Schedule follow-ups
- Generate reports
Instead of navigating multiple menus, users simply ask the chatbot.
This approach reduces friction in digital systems and allows employees or customers to interact with applications using natural language.

Key Use Cases for Embedded AI Chatbots
Businesses across industries are embedding chatbots into applications to improve efficiency and user engagement. Some common examples include:
1. Customer Service Applications
Support platforms now integrate chatbots that can answer questions, resolve issues, and escalate complex cases automatically.
These bots access customer data directly within the system, making responses more accurate and contextual.
2. Internal Workflow Automation
Inside internal business tools, chatbots can automate tasks like data entry, scheduling, or approval workflows.
Employees simply describe what they need, and the chatbot completes the action.
3. E-commerce and Retail Apps
Retail applications often integrate chatbots to guide users through product discovery, checkout processes, and order tracking.
Some bots can even add products to carts or suggest items based on preferences.
4. Data Analytics and Reporting
Instead of building complex dashboards, companies are embedding AI assistants that allow users to ask questions about business data.
For example:
“Show me sales trends for the last quarter.”
The chatbot analyzes the data and generates insights instantly.

Understanding API Integrations in Simple Terms
An API, or Application Programming Interface, acts as a bridge between different software applications. It allows one system to request data or trigger actions in another system.
For example:
- A website sending customer data to a CRM
- An e-commerce store connecting to a payment gateway
- A marketing tool pulling leads from a form submission platform
Traditionally, developers had to manually configure these integrations by writing backend code and managing authentication systems. This process required technical expertise and continuous maintenance.

Why Businesses Need Seamless Tool Integrations
Disconnected tools create inefficiencies within organizations. Teams often spend valuable time copying data from one platform to another, which increases the chances of errors and inconsistent records.
API integrations help eliminate these issues by allowing applications to exchange information automatically. Some key benefits include:
- Automation of repetitive tasks: Data can move between platforms instantly without manual intervention.
- Improved operational efficiency: Employees spend less time switching between tools and more time focusing on meaningful work.
- Accurate data synchronization: Integrated systems ensure that analytics, dashboards, and reports always reflect real-time information.
- Better scalability: As companies grow and adopt more software tools, integrations help maintain smooth operations.
